


We at Milk Creek Reds invite you to view our offering for the 2025 Bull Sale. Our hope is that as you view the information in this catalog that you will be able to see differences within the offering but also that there is consistency throughout the offering.
Tena reminded us that it has been 40 years sine we purchased our first registered Red Angus females. It is hard to believe that we have been in this business for that many decades. We have seen many changes in the cattle, the industry and our business over these years. One of the many things that we have discovered is that even with all these changes we still have not figured out how to breed the perfect cow or bull. This can be disappointing and challenging at the same time. In the end, there really isn’t a perfect animal that we can breed because as a breeder we are very critical in evaluating cattle and thus we will always find that something could be better. Instead, our philosophy has been to breed cattle that are very functional, adaptable, and profitable to our operation as well as our customers operations that have the same business philosophies.
This year’s offering was selected from over 200 herd mates which has allowed these bulls to be consistent in type and kind with a variety of different pedigrees represented. Amongst the tried and true reference sires that we have utilized in the past are a few new A.I. and clean up sires, whose offspring will be the first offered from our program. The progeny from all the reference sires have a common denominator, which is to produce functional, profitable females that will generate as much production within their environment with as few as inputs possible.
Eastern Montana experienced another drought and that meant the bulls weaned off a little lighter than we would have hoped but when they were able to get some nutrition in front of them they exhibited good compensatory gain. The bulls are being fed by Eric and Andrea Bowman and family at Rhame, North Dakota. The Bowmans have been feeding our bulls for 30 + years and have developed this set of bulls to gain around 2.5 pounds per day but with the nice winter they have been doing a little better. While being developed with longevity in mind, the bulls are still fed in a way that allows them to express their gain potential.
This year could be a pivotal year for our breed when it comes to marketing commercial feeder calves sired by Red Angus bulls. Our breed association has been making inroads with feeders and packers to open up more opportunity for red cattle to be priced based on genetic merit not hide color. New packing plants are being opened and more feeders are educated on the quality of Red Angus feeder cattle with hopes of improving pricing on a more competitive level with black hided cattle. Change usually takes time and in this industry sometimes it doesn’t move as fast as we would like.

The bulls received Vision 7 at branding, preconditioned in August with Bovishield Gold One Shot and Vision 7 Somnus. The bulls were boostered with Bovishield Gold in September. They received a Fusogard injection in December and a booster in January. Bulls were given a shot of Valcor in November, poured with Clean-Up II in December, poured with Inihibidor in January and Clean-Up II in February. Semen evaluations were performed by Fallon County Vet Service prior to the sale and all the evaluation forms will be available sale day. Bulls that do not pass the semen evaluation will be available for sale after they have a satisfactory evaluation.
The bulls are fed on a ration to develop them into sound functional useable bulls that will work in every environment. The ration consists of rolled corn (6.25 lbs. average), corn silage 14 lbs., dry distiller’s (3.0 lbs.), and the balance of chopped hay that consists of ground grass, alfalfa, and barley hay, along with a vitamin/mineral supplement. This ration is developed to use 1% of the feed base being grain to reach our goal of 2.5 lbs. gain. They have been developed at Eric and Andrea Bowman’s feedlot which is located 1 mile south of Rhame, ND.

We continue to use Ridge Admiral in our AI sire lineup because of how his progeny perform in our environment. The bulls have been well received by our commercial as well as registered customers and the oldest females are now 10 years old and bringing in good calves while functioning very well in our enviroment. You will see some of his daughters bringing bulls to this offering. This will be the last large group of natural born sons that we will be offering. We are down to a limited supply of semen and will be using Admiral selectively on certain cows and in our ET program. While this bull does well on all the indicies, when you study the numbers, his growth EPDs that are not what some people would say are ideal, yet it is where we like them to be for the female to fit our enviroment. After three trips to Canada studying the cow herd at U2, we came to the conclusion that we needed to sample a pedigree that worked multiple times in their program. After studying the bull calves in the fall as well as at their 2019 bull sale, and studying the cows both in the spring and fall, we selected Money Talks. We used Money Talks (530F) on both heifers and cows AI and then turned him in with 50 plus head of first calf heifers for natural service and had only three opens. He has now recorded 341 progeny in five calving seasons and we are very pleased in the balance of birth, performance, carcass and phenotype. We are calving his fourth set of daughters and they are displaying excellent udders and feet while being good mothers.

ProS ..... Profitability and Sustainability is an all-purpose index that predicts average economic differences in all segments in the beef supply chain. This index is a combination of the breeding objectives modeled in the HerdBuilder and GridMaster selection indexes. In this index, replacement heifers are retained from within the herd and all remaining progeny are fed out to slaughter and sold on a quality-based grid. Traits included in this index include calving ease, growth, HPG, STAY, Mature Weight, Dry Matter Intake and carcass traits. The resulting index is expressed in dollars per head born (Index/High Value).
HB ....... HerdBuilder is a maternal selection index that predicts the economic differences of animals for traits that are important from conception through weaning. Expressed as dollars per head born, HB is calculated based on the scenario that bulls are mated to heifers and cows, replacement heifers are retained and all remaining progeny are marketed at weaning. Traits included in the HB index include Calving Ease Direct, Calving Ease Maternal, Weaning Weight, Milk, Mature Weight, Heifer Pregnancy and Stayability (Index/High Value).
GM....... GridMaster is a selection index that predicts the average economic difference of non-replacement calves through the post-weaning phase of production. GM places selection pressure on growth, feedyard performance and carcass traits. Expressed as dollars per head born, GM is calculated based on the scenario that progeny are fed out to slaughter and marketed on a quality-based carcass grid. Traits included in GM include Average Daily Gain, Carcass Weight, Dry Matter Intake, Marbling, Back Fat and Rib Eye Area (Index/High Value).
CED ........ Calving Ease Direct predicts differences in the percent of calves born unassisted out of 2-year-old dams. (Percent/High Value)
BW ........ Birth Weight predicts differences in actual birth weight of progeny. (Pounds/Low Value)
WW Weaning Weight predicts differences in 205-day weaning weight. (Pounds/High Value)
YW Yearling Weight predicts differences in 365-day yearling weight. (Pounds/High Value)
ADG ....... Average Daily Gain predicts differences in weight gain between 205 and 365 days of age. (Pounds/High Value)
DMI Dry Matter Intake predicts differences in daily feed intake as measured in a feedlot during the post-weaning period. (Pounds/Low Value)
MILK Milk predicts differences in weaning weight attributed to the milking ability of the animal’s daughters. (Pounds/High Value)
ME ........ Maintenance Energy predicts the difference in maintence energy requirements. (Mcal per Month/Low Value)
HPG Heifer Pregnancy predicts differences in the percent of daughters who are able to conceive and calve at 2 years of age following exposure to breeding. (Percent/High Value)
CEM ...... Calving Ease Maternal predicts differences in the percent of daughters who are able to calve unassisted as 2-year-old heifers. (Percent/High Value)
STAY Stayability predicts differences in the ability of an animals’ retained daughters to remain productive in the herd – calve every year – through 6 years of age. (Percent/High Value)
MARB .... Marbling predicts differences in marbling score – amount of intramuscular fat measured at the 13th rib. (Marbling Score Units/High Value)
YG Yield Grade predicts differences in USDA Yield Grade, which is calculated using CW, REA and Fat. (Yield Grade Units/Low Value)
CW Carcass Weight predicts differences in actual hot carcass weight. (Pounds/High Value)
REA Ribeye Area predicts differences in square inches of ribeye area measured at the 13th rib.(Square Inches/High Value)
FAT Fat predicts differences in the depth of backfat measured between the 12th and 13th ribs. (Inches/Low Value)

The cattle industry is constantly changing and feeders and packers seem to be the drivers in directing that change. Their ability to direct change is related to the concentration of ownership within these two segments of our industry. Both segments keep increasing the size of animal that they want to feed and harvest because of their efficiency of producing more pounds of beef per animal and reducing the costs by feeding and harvesting less head of cattle and leaving them within the feedlot for longer periods of time. What impacts their bottom line is diametrically opposed to what impacts the cow/calf producers bottom line.
In our segment of the industry, most cow/calf producers raise cattle in an environment that has limitations to what it can produce hindering our ability to meet the changes without increasing input feed costs to sustain the larger, higher output cattle that the feeders and packers are looking for. Coupled with this the feed input costs has increased dramatically over the past four years compounding the problems to reach profitability within our segment of the industry.
I am thankful that our Red Angus Association staff is working hard to educate the industry on the quality of Red Angus cattle and how they can reach all the requirements in the branded packer programs that have been set for Angus cattle. Through this effort, the USDA has recognized Red Angus as Angus so that they are able to qualify in all programs with the exception of CAB which is owned by the Angus Association. This education is going to take time to develop traction and will eventually open more marketing opportunities for our cattle. In the meantime, the industry is using excuses to discount red hided cattle so that they can add more profit to their segment of the industry. With the current cattle inventory, we are hopeful that the next three years will see above average feeder cattle demand which will diminish the ability for discounts because of hide color.
We continue striving to produce cattle that will be able to thrive in a grass-based environment without any inputs other than salt, mineral and some hay when needed due to drought or severe winter conditions. When you study the genetics that we are using you might ask, why don’t you use higher growth sires to increase the weights of your calves? The answer lies in what we have discovered when we have attempted to do that very thing. Most sires that we have used to accomplish this, with exceptions of a few outliers, tend to produce females that have a higher percentage chance of failing to breed as yearlings or first-calf heifers because they have a higher energy requirement than what our natural environment can provide. That can become very expensive when you account for the time and dollars invested in developing those females to that stage.
The sires that we are using will still push the envelop of producing offspring with performance that is limited by our environment on any given year because our weaning weights can fluctuate 50-100 pounds based on when and how much rain falls from the sky. We continue to search the breed for the outliers that will push the performance as well as carcass traits but will not give up the fertility and longevity developed within the herd which are the key profit drivers for any cow-calf operation.
